VGA Settings

VGA Out
To enhance the local video quality, a VGA monitor may be connected.
Main:
Should be used if you want to use a VGA monitor as your main monitor. Video outputs 1&3 will
be disabled.
Dual:
Should be used if you want to use a VGA monitor as your dual monitor. Video outputs 2&4 will
be disabled.
Loop:
'VGA Out' will display whatever is present on 'VGA In'. All video outputs will be enabled. The
VGA monitor will act as a third monitor.
VGA Out Quality
VGA Out Quality changes the resolution of the VGA signal available on the 'VGA Out' connector at the rear of the
codec.
